All of our animals are neutered, vaccinated and micro chipped. They are all up to date with Flea and worming. All of our animals are health checked by a vet and come with six weeks free Pet insurance if you register on adoption. There is a small adoption fee of just £50 for cats and kittens, dogs are on application. This in no way covers the costs to the branch but just helps us continue our work.
